Noun: downpour  'dawn,por
  1. A heavy rainstorm
    "The clouds broke after the heavy downpour";
    - cloudburst, deluge, waterspout, torrent, pelter, soaker, gullywasher [US, informal]

Derived forms: downpours

Type of: rain, rainfall
